使用Spring+Hibernate的HibernateDaoSupport的getHibernateTemplate().find(HQL)进行查询时,总是报这样的错误:
java.lang.NoClassDefFoundError: antlr/ANTLRException
开始没有注意到这个,只看下面的详细情况.结果怎么调试也不行.没办法,搜索了一下antlr/ANTLRException,结果发现是少了antlr包.
本文介绍了一种在使用Spring和Hibernate框架时遇到的问题:通过HibernateDaoSupport执行HQL查询时出现java.lang.NoClassDefFoundError异常,特别是涉及antlr/ANTLRException的情况。文章指出缺少antlr包是导致该问题的原因,并提供了相应的解决方案。
使用Spring+Hibernate的HibernateDaoSupport的getHibernateTemplate().find(HQL)进行查询时,总是报这样的错误:
java.lang.NoClassDefFoundError: antlr/ANTLRException
开始没有注意到这个,只看下面的详细情况.结果怎么调试也不行.没办法,搜索了一下antlr/ANTLRException,结果发现是少了antlr包.
您可能感兴趣的与本文相关的镜像
Anything-LLM
AnythingLLM是一个全栈应用程序,可以使用商用或开源的LLM/嵌入器/语义向量数据库模型,帮助用户在本地或云端搭建个性化的聊天机器人系统,且无需复杂设置

被折叠的 条评论
为什么被折叠?